Johni Broome joins company of Larry Bird with standout performance against MSU

Johni Broome had a performance to remember in the 70-64 Elite Eight victory against Michigan State, but it didn’t come without a major scare. Broome went to block a shot in the second half, and landed awkwardly on both his wrist and his knee. He walked to the bench and locker room, telling his teammates that he thought he was done.
However, the tests were negative, and he came back into the game and hit a 3-pointer to help push the lead to double digits.
He finished the game with 25 points and 14 rebounds and joined the company of Larry Bird with his incredible game.
He joined Bird as the only 2 players to ever have a 25 point, 12+ rebound game on 75% from the field against a top-2 seed. Bird’s was in the 1979 Final Four against DePaul.
For Tigers fans, they would not be disappointed if Broome had a similar performance in the Final Four matchup against the Florida Gators. These 2 teams played once in the regular season, with the Gators winning that game 90-81. In that matchup, Broome had 18 points, 11 rebounds and 6 assists.
Tipoff is scheduled for 6:09 p.m. ET, and will be live from San Antonio. The winner of that game will face the winner of Duke and Houston.
